Understanding Bar Code Scanning Conveyors

Bar code scanning conveyors are automated systems designed to read bar codes on products as they move through the supply chain. These conveyors are celebrated for enhancing speed and efficiency, but how do they impact the accuracy of the products being processed?

Best Practices for Implementation

To harness the benefits of bar code scanning conveyors without sacrificing product accuracy, experts recommend several best practices:

  • Regular Calibration: Ensure the scanning systems are calibrated regularly to minimize misreads.
  • Training: Provide comprehensive training for staff to properly handle and troubleshoot scanning equipment.
  • System Checks: Implement routine quality checks and balance out speed with accuracy metrics to monitor performance.
